Job Title: Recreation & Activities Coordinator

At Parexel, we are a leading Clinical Research Organization (CRO) specializing in delivering life‑changing medicines to patients. We are seeking a Recreation and Activities Coordinator to join our team. In this role, you’ll work toward building a deeper connection and understanding with those who count on us most. Through questioning the status quo and collaborating cross‑functionally, the Recreation and Activities Coordinator is responsible for enhancing participant well‑being, coordinating therapeutic activities, and supporting daily procedures during inpatient Early Phase clinical trials.

What you’ll do:

Coordination and Planning

  • Coordinate and plan participant recreation activities tailored to study design and individual interests
  • Create, maintain, and post a monthly activity calendar
  • Coordinate with vendors and contractors to schedule recreational events
  • Communicate regularly with the CRC’s to be aware of study specific food restrictions, sunlight exposure restrictions, holter and monitor hours with activity restrictions, Etc.
  • Coordinate team-building activities for staff

Participant Interaction and Support

  • Interact regularly with study participants to enhance well‑being and promote social engagement
  • Assist participants with routine activities and procedures such as meals, fasting schedules, toiletry distribution, scrubs, and laundry
  • Encourage and remind participants of unit rules and general guidelines

Communication and Reporting

  • Monitor participant comfort and notify clinical teams of any notable changes or concerns
  • Review participant satisfaction survey and adjust activities based on feedback
  • Review the Unit calendar regularly to have a comprehensive overview of admissions and discharges of different studies and the dorm occupancy plan
  • Review study participant needs and restrictions with CRC’s and nurses to determine course of therapy

Training and Compliance

  • Train staff who support participant recreational activities
  • Maintain knowledge of SOPs, hospital policies, and procedures, applying them consistently in daily work
